In The Book Lover, a charming bookshop in the village of Warwick, New York, the best stories may not be in the pages of its books, but in the lives of the people who walk through its doors. Owner Ruth Hardaway has been handselling books in her store, The Book Lover, for years. Her gift isn't just finding the right books for her quirky cast of patrons, its also helping them to navigate the unexpected chapters in their own lives. When author Lucy Barrett lands on her doorstep for a book signing, only to collapse in a meltdown, Ruth is about to become a heroine in a story she never could have imagined. As for Lucy, who's left a terrible betrayal behind, she's about to encounter a plot twist she couldn't have written when Ruth's son, a disabled vet who rescues injured raptors, causes her to question everything she thought she wanted.
